About the job:

  • Drive the design and execution of HR initiatives, including talent management (Orientation, Performance Management, training, new hire onboarding), employee engagement, and organizational development

  • Provide support to managers on a wide range of HR topics, including employee relations, HR regulations and policies, and performance issues

  • Oversee the management and progress of local recruitment initiatives and Recruiters

  • Assists with the development and administration of programs, procedures and guidelines to support Corporate HR and Business priorities

  • Administers HR policies procedures and programs in service of the HR team

  • Conducts data analysis for the business to support the implementation of human resource programs processes and services aligned to talent, performance and compensation, organization design, assessments and talent planning

  • Provides advice and counsel to managers and employees on all performance related issues, including identifying key talent, organizational planning, recognition and rewards, attendance/performance issues, performance improvement and terminations, employee relations issues, and corporate people movement

What We Do

Founded in 1987, Huawei is a leading global provider of information and communications technology (ICT) infrastructure and smart devices. We are committed to bringing digital to every person, home and organization for a fully connected, intelligent world. We have approximately 197,000 employees and we operate in over 170 countries and regions, serving more than three billion people around the world. In Canada, Huawei conducts innovative and leading edge research in 5G technologies, along with advanced development of emerging cloud, device and network technologies & services. While our renowned Canada Research Centre in the thriving technology landscape of Ottawa, Ontario continues to grow rapidly in size and strategic product initiatives, additional presence has also been established across Canada with R&D facilities in Vancouver, Edmonton, Waterloo, Markham, Montreal, and a R&D office in Quebec City.
